Moldeados Plásticos Alber has updated two of its most successful series, incorporating anti-spiralization grooves. These are the MCF 7, MCF 9, MCA 9 and MCB 9 models, made up of tall pots with mesh bottoms for the plantation of young plants, which will now also have the aforementioned grooves that direct the roots, guaranteeing good rooting.
This system of channels prevents them from rolling up on themselves and their possible strangulation, compromising the stability and development of the plant. Specifically, given their characteristics, these pots are ideal for the propagation of blueberries, olive trees, almond trees, etc.
